Step-by-step explanation:
3x² - 18x + 5 = 47 ( subtract 5 from both sides )
3x² - 18x = 42 ( divide through by 3 )
x² - 6x = 14
Using the method of completing the square
add ( half the coefficient of the x- term )² to both sides
x² + 2(- 3)x + 9 = 14 + 9
(x - 3)² = 23 ( take square root of both sides )
x - 3 = ±
( add 3 to both sides )
x = 3 ±

Answer: 125lb < M < 155 lb
Step-by-step explanation:
The mean mass is 140 lb, and the deviation must be less than 15 pounds (exactly 15 is not accepted).
Then (140lb + 15lb) is not alowed, and (140lb - 15lb) is not alowed.
Then we can define M = mass.
We have the two equations:
M < 140lb + 15lb
M < 155lb
And
M > (140lb - 15lb)
M > 125lb
If we write these two relations togheter, we get:
125lb < M < 155 lb
